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83839 0707041663 8830614
852 5427510069
852 5427510069
0412207 638091712 6254447450
All about undefined
Interested in learning more?
852 5427510069
0412207 638091712 6254447450
See more
0335046567 7265061 3808
7385 38209 751481 926616
See more
680689231 8929 376950
6723 478138 7639223 25
See more